Output dd677bf8f241601dc754025289880af1e98a7499fac3705faa57d915d5c95d30:0

value
6968003845271
script pubkey
OP_0 OP_PUSHBYTES_20 9eddc108058071ad87739c226dc639267ce6ba28
address
tb1qnmwuzzq9spc6mpmnns3xm33eye7wdw3g3v93w4
transaction
dd677bf8f241601dc754025289880af1e98a7499fac3705faa57d915d5c95d30
confirmations
165342
spent
true